Humberside Police are searching for a 13-year-old boy who goes missing after swimming in the sea off Hornsea. The incident takes place on Tuesday evening near the South Promenade area, according to police statements cited by multiple outlets. Emergency services are called at around 6pm, with reports describing the boy as having entered the water and not being located afterward. Outlets describe the response as a search and rescue operation involving police and other emergency services. The search focuses on the shoreline and surrounding sea area off the North Sea coast near Hornsea.
